H1Z1's Lead Animator Passes Away
A less publicly recognized -- but still incredibly important -- member of the Daybreak team passed away this week. Dave "Sarge" Carter, who was most recently the lead animator for the zombie survival game H1Z1, spent 25 years in the industry. During that time, he worked on not just Daybreak products (although some players may have seen his work in PlanetSide 2) but other popular games such as Unreal Tournament, Borderlands, Saints Row, Doom 4, Red Faction, and Brothers in Arms.

Former Daybreak CEO John Smedley also sent out a tweet calling Carter a "top-tier animator" and an "amazing teammate." He also told Massively that Carter's passing "really made [him] sad, noting that he was "amazing to work with", and calling him "an optimist".
